If Montgomery's tubercles, which are small glands on the areola, pop or become inflamed, it's essential to keep the area clean and dry to prevent infection. Avoid squeezing or further irritating the area. If there is persistent pain, swelling, or signs of infection (such as pus or increased redness), consult a healthcare professional for evaluation and treatment. Maintaining good breast hygiene and wearing breathable fabrics can help prevent further issues.
